您的位置:首页 > Web前端 > JavaScript

jsp 之 入门 jsp指令(page,include,taglib)

2017-12-04 22:34 573 查看

jsp指令是指导jsp的翻译和运行的指令:

<%@ jsp指令  属性名="属性值"  ....%>

jsp指令:

1.page 可以设置页面属性

2.include 页面包含

3.taglib 引入标签库

page:

属性
属性值
默认
作用
autoFlush
true/false
TRUE
buffer
none/sizeKB
8KB
contentType
MIME格式
text/html; charset=ISO-8859-1
调用HttpServletResponse.setContentType();
deferredSyntaxAllowedAsLiteral
true/false
FALSE
是否允许出现${..}。如果该属性的值为false(默认值),当模板文本中出现${..}时,将引发页面转换错误
errorPage
错误的处理方式
FALSE
可以设置跳转到某个页面
extends
指定继承的父类
慎用
import
指定导入包
java.lang.*;
javax.servlet.*; 
javax.servlet.jsp.*;
javax.servlet.http.*;
info
页面简介
isELIgnored
true/false
FALSE
是否忽略EL表达式.如果值为ture那么像
${..}这样的直接会原样输出,不会进行EL表达式运算
isErrorPage
true/false
FALSE
是否是错误页面,默认是false,如果你这个是很多界面跳转的错误页面(500),设置为true
isThreadSafe
true/false
TRUE
是否支持多线程
language
语言
java
sun公司本来想让这个以后做一个通用的模板,但是目前并没有,只有java
pageEncoding
JSP网页编码格式
你jsp文件的编码格式
session
true/false
TRUE
是否执行HttpSession session = HttpServletRequest.getSession().这样就可以方便的使用session.setAttribute(“”.””)等…
trimDirectiveWhitespaces
true/false
FALSE
删除多余的空行.建议设置true,提高性能

include:

页面包含

<%@ include file="被包含的文件地址" %>

taglib:

<%@ taglib url="标签库地址" prefix="前缀" %>
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: